Ground Nutmeg
Ground nutmeg is a spice made from the seed of the nutmeg tree, known for its warm, sweet flavor and aromatic qualities. It is commonly used in both sweet and savory dishes, as well as in beverages.
Apple
Apples are a popular fruit known for their crisp texture and sweet-tart flavor. They are rich in dietary fiber, vitamins, and antioxidants, making them a nutritious choice for a healthy diet.

2. Micronutrient Profile (Vitamins and Minerals)
Micronutrient analysis highlights the essential vitamins and minerals of each food, expressed as a percentage of the recommended Daily Value (%DV).
Ground Nutmeg's profile is highly notable for: manganese (1.2mg, 60% VDR) and magnesium (183mg, 46% VDR) and calcium (184mg, 18% VDR).
Conversely, Apple stands out especially in: vitamin-c (4.6mg, 5% VDR) and potassium (107mg, 3% VDR).
